Caroline Mills is a scholar working on Dermatology, Epidemiology and Cell Biology. According to data from OpenAlex, Caroline Mills has authored 40 papers receiving a total of 853 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Dermatology, 13 papers in Epidemiology and 6 papers in Cell Biology. Recurrent topics in Caroline Mills's work include Nail Diseases and Treatments (7 papers), Dermatology and Skin Diseases (5 papers) and Contact Dermatitis and Allergies (5 papers). Caroline Mills is often cited by papers focused on Nail Diseases and Treatments (7 papers), Dermatology and Skin Diseases (5 papers) and Contact Dermatitis and Allergies (5 papers). Caroline Mills collaborates with scholars based in United Kingdom, United States and Australia. Caroline Mills's co-authors include A.Y. Finlay, Calista Long, G L Swift, Sean W. Lanigan, P.J.A. HOLT, R. Marks, Robert G. Newcombe, I M Harvey, T. J. Peters and J. Rhodes and has published in prestigious journals such as The Lancet, Journal of Investigative Dermatology and British journal of surgery.
